AMX NMX-ATC-N4321D Audio-over-IP Transceiver with Dante and AES67
Product Description
The AMX NMX-ATC-N4321D is a professional Audio-over-IP (AoIP) transceiver designed to seamlessly connect and bridge IP-based and analog audio networks. Supporting Dante®, AES67, PCM Audio-over-IP, and both balanced and unbalanced analog audio, it enables flexible audio transport, conversion, switching, and distribution across a wide range of AV environments.
